St Croix Nsr - Schoen Park campground
St Croix Nsr - Schoen Park
Reservations are not accepted at the Schoen Park camping area, and sites are available on a first-come, first-served basis. It is recommended to arrive early, especially during peak seasons, to secure a spot. The best time to visit this camping area is from late spring to early fall when the weather is mild and the river is ideal for various recreational activities such as boating, fishing, and hiking.
Campers should be aware of a few precautions when visiting the Schoen Park camping area. The riverway can be prone to sudden changes in water levels, so it is important to stay updated on weather conditions and river forecasts. In addition, it is advised to bring insect repellent as mosquitoes and ticks can be present in the area. Overall, St Croix NSR - Schoen Park camping area is a picturesque and serene destination for outdoor enthusiasts to enjoy the natural beauty of Wisconsin's St Croix River.

Camping essentials & Leave No Trace
- Pack it in, pack it out
- Take all trash, food scraps, and gear back with you to keep campsites clean and protect wildlife.
- Respect wildlife
- Observe animals from a distance, store food securely, and never feed wildlife to maintain natural behavior and safety.
- Know before you go
- Check weather, fire restrictions, trail conditions, and permit requirements to ensure a safe and well-planned trip.
- Minimize campfire impact
- Use established fire rings, keep fires small, fully extinguish them, or opt for a camp stove when fires are restricted.
- Leave what you find
- Preserve natural and cultural features by avoiding removal of plants, rocks, artifacts, or other elements of the environment.
